DR. RAYMOND T. AGIA: Mere luck. It was going to happen anyhow but someone in Miami, while treating patients for macular degeneration found out that they came to him and said, “Hey, we’re seeing better.” He started thinking about what these patients were going through. They were taking Avastin which is a drug used for colorectal cancer. At the same time he noted that the vision has improved. So he started thinking maybe the Avastin is helping patients with macular degeneration. It was an uproar in the retinal society because we said maybe finally we have a cure for macular degeneration. It is a not a cure yet but it is a process where we can slow down the disease and in some cases now we do have improvement of vision. They discovered that there is another medication from this same family. They named it Lucentis. Every one of the countries is using Lucentis because it does help patients who are deemed, again, hopeless and helpless. Now we do have—not a cure so far—but we do have a way to retard the disease, stop it, and many times improve the vision even. What is in the future? There are many, many research activities going on at the same time everywhere. Here, in Europe, in Japan, and the hope that one day they will be able to cure the disease for once and for all which is the number one cause of blindness in the Western Hemisphere.
